Kenya Broadcasting Corporation is a State Corporation established under the KBC Act
(Cap. 221) and operating under the Ministry of Information, Communications and the
Digital Economy.

The Corporation is seeking to engage six (6) qualified and motivated interns to undertake internship programmes for a maximum (non-renewable) period of twelve (12) months in the following Departments as per the outlined basic requirements:-

Internship Programmes

  1. Technical Services Department (Transmission /Production) – Intern
  2. Television Programmes Department (Design) – Intern
  3. Radio Services Department ( Creative) – Intern
  4. Digital Department – Intern – 2 posts
  5. Legal Department – Intern

Technical Services Department (Transmission /Production) – Intern

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ree OR Diploma in Telecommunicationi or Electrical Engineering from a recognized Institution
  • Must be computer literate
  • Knowledge in transmission and production

Television Programmes Department (Design) – Intern

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ree OR Diploma in Graphic design /3D Graphic design or its equivalent from a recognized Institution
  • Computer Proficiency
  •  Creativity and innovativeness

Radio Services Department ( Creative) – Intern

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elor’s Degree OR Diplomain Journalism, Mass Communication, or Broadcast Journalism from a recognized Institution
  • Must be computer literate
  • Fluency in English and Kiswahili
  • Strong oral communication, writing, editing and analytical skills

Digital Department – Intern – 2 posts

Minimum requirements:

  •  Bachelor of Science Degree OR Diploma in Computer Scienceo/Soft Ware Engineering/ Information Technlogy/Computer Programming/Web Development or Soft Ware Development.

OR

  • Bacheor’s Degree OR Diploma in Journalism , Mass Communication, Media Studies, Public Relations, Graphic Design from a recognized University
  • Practical skills in either Web Development, Soft ware Development, Mobile App Development or Database Development
  • Familiarity with social media platforms

Legal Department – Intern

Minimum requ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Law from a recognized Institution
  • Must be computer literate
  • Drafting, report writing, planning and organisational skills.

Other requirements:

  • Kenyan youth aged between 21 and 34 years
  • Have graduated from College / University not earlier than the year 2019
  • Must attach copies of certificates, academic transcripts, updated curriculum vitae, national identity card or passport alongside the application letter
  • Must indicate the specific area of interest / department covered in the advert.
